    A great many problems about the viscoelastic bodies are left without being solved. Materials such as steel and glass, often regarded as elastic at ordinary temperatures, on close observations are found also to exhibit small amounts of viscous behavior. This can be observed as creep (increase of deformation at constant stress) or stress relaxation (decay of elastic stress at constant deformation), and these effects may be important under certain conditions of use. To return to our subject it was mentioned in the report of the past that the viscoelastic constant can be decided by using the method of least squares and also the compressive test subjected to a linearly increasing strain ε_ot was tried at different rate of strain, amount of filler, and amount of asphalt. It is generally said that the stress-strain curve is largely affected by the rate of strain, so we made a special study of asphalt mixture at different rate of strain. But, in the past, the fastest rate of strain was 10mm/min, so we intended to examine the stress-strain curve of the asphalt mixture under the conditions of more faster rate of strain. The results of experiments are mentioned in this paper.
